The NZ Transport Agency Board

Board committees

The NZTA has five Board committees, made up of the agency’s Board members.

Each committee has between three and four members, including a committee chair.  Committees have a quorum of 3, including the chair. 

Members are appointed by resolution of the Board, on the basis of their skills, knowledge and experience in the relevant committee’s subject. 

Committees have a terms of reference, with specific purposes, accountabilities and delegations and they report to the Board at the relevant forthcoming Board meeting. 

All minutes of committee meetings are reported to the Board with recommendations as appropriate. 

The State Highways Board Committee and Strategic and Investments Board Committee meet monthly, with the other three committees meeting every two to three months.
